Output 889356e605b32cf9ad68e37bf8cca59926ae5bf572c67e4572c3401015228db9:2

value
28842356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c91f46fcdcd995f767dd1966a729c017e9c0dbf OP_EQUAL
address
MDRRd4QGJBpKRFMCaF4idt33PD5N7GmXAw
transaction
889356e605b32cf9ad68e37bf8cca59926ae5bf572c67e4572c3401015228db9
spent
true